Zusammenfassung: | The invention discloses a preprocessing method for an ion exchange resin for treating waste water at tail end of electrolytic manganese manufacturing technique. The preprocessing method comprises the following steps of soaking a 001*7 gel-type cation exchange resin for 6-10h by using 10%-15% Na2SO4 solution or 20%-25% H2SO4 solution, wherein the volume of the Na2SO4 solution or the H2SO4 solution is 1.5-2.5 times of that of the resin; cleaning; soaking the cleaned 001*7 gel-type cation exchange resin by adopting 2-6% HCl solution for 3-5h, wherein the volume of the HCl solution is 1.5-2.5 times of the volume of the resin; cleaning the gel-type cation exchange resin by using fresh water till the resin is neutral ; and soaking the treated resin by using 2-6% NaOH solution for 3-5h, wherein the volume of the NaOH solution is 1.5-2.5 times of the volume of the resin.
